GOING BI-ANNUAL: Starting with issues 15(3) and 15(4), The Inner Swine is going bi-annual, kids. This means that we'll be putting out 2 issues a year instead of 4. The good news is, the issues will be double size, so we're not going to lose much by way of material and your reading pleasure. We might have to drop the issues to 100pp instead of 120pp due to simple stapling physics limitations, but more or less the issues will be double sized. Why are we doing this? Because making up 4 batches a year is just too much work for lazy bastards like us. This way we get to create just as much material, but only have to sit and fold/staple/stuff twice a year instead of four times. IT'S GENIUS. So, issue 15(2) will hit you in June (or, more likely these days, July) as usual. Then issues 15(3) and 15(4) will be one double issue which will come out in December. We're still honoring subscriptions and lifetime subs as before, counting each issue starting with 15(3)/15(4) as one issue--so actually, subscribers will do better overall. Prices will stay the same for now, though we might inch them up a bit later. Any questions? Email me at mreditor@innerswine.com CURRENT ISSUE
